Baku – APA. APA’s interview with Azerbaijani parliamentarian Jeyhun Osmanli

-The delegation of which you are also a member will tomorrow start visit to Paris and London. What is the aim of the visit?

-The aim of the visit is to acquaint with the Azerbaijanis studying in France and UK through state and non-state programs. We should pay attention to the education, domestic problems of the Azerbaijanis studying abroad. In terms of development of human capital in Azerbaijan, President of Azerbaijan Mr. Ilham Aliyev focuses his attention on the investment in the youth, their all-round development. Alongside with the development the young people should not break relations with the motherland, national statehood ideas should exist both abroad and in Azerbaijan. Therefore, it is important to play the role of a bridge between the growing youth, their problems and existing opportunities. Our youth living in various countries should contact with one another, come together for important projects in terms of Azerbaijan’s interests. Of course, the target of each student should first of all be to get thorough education, to be professional. The delegation includes Youth and Sport Minister Azad Rahimov, head of Political Analysis and Information Department of Azerbaijani Presidential Administration Elnur Aslanov, President of State Oil Fond Shahmar Movsumov, Deputy Minister of Education Elmar Gasimov, sector chief of the Presidential Administration’s international relations department Hasan Mammadzadeh, chairman of Azerbaijani Students and Alumni International Forum (ASAIF) Orkhan Akbarov and others.

-When and where will the meetings be held in Paris and London?

-The meeting with our students in France will be held at the embassy of Azerbaijan in France at 14.00 on December 5, the meeting with the students in the UK will be held in the Royal Garden Hotel in London at 17.00 on December 6.

-What other issues does the program of the meeting cover?

-Our students will be able to get answer to any question at the meeting. I am sure that the meetings will be very interactive. Moreover, chairman of ASAIF Orkhan Akbarov will hold presentation of the organization, meet with the representatives of the organization in Paris and London, the projects implemented by ASAIF will be analyzed, future projects will be discussed. Meetings will also be held at some universities, where Azerbaijanis are studying.
